CVE-2024-12672 2024-12-19 20h58 +00:00 A third-party vulnerability exists in the Rockwell Automation Arena® that could allow a threat actor to write beyond the boundaries of allocated memory in a DOE file. If exploited, a threat actor could leverage this vulnerability to execute arbitrary code. To exploit this vulnerability, a legitimate user must execute the malicious code crafted by the threat actor.

CVE-2024-2929 2024-03-26 15h56 +00:00 A memory corruption vulnerability in Rockwell Automation Arena Simulation software could potentially allow a malicious user to insert unauthorized code to the software by corrupting the memory triggering an access violation. Once inside, the threat actor can run harmful code on the system. This affects the confidentiality, integrity, and availability of the product. To trigger this, the user would unwittingly need to open a malicious file shared by the threat actor.

CVE-2024-21920 2024-03-26 15h48 +00:00 A memory buffer vulnerability in Rockwell Automation Arena Simulation could potentially let a threat actor read beyond the intended memory boundaries. This could reveal sensitive information and even cause the application to crash, resulting in a denial-of-service condition. To trigger this, the user would unwittingly need to open a malicious file shared by the threat actor.
